Billing themselves as the creators of ‘the most unreliable music since 1999’, Flat Earth Society (FES) are a multi-media arts ensemble with the spirit, musicality and gusto of Frank Zappa. They are Belgium's answer to Loose Tubes. This 3-CD set is a very good representation of their works' evolution. Non-Flemish speakers might find CD-1 Boot & Berg, a Belgian opera on the subject of the Sinking of the Titanic recorded in 2012, a little hard going but it's never dull. FES are rarely unreachable musically, though always springing new surprises, covering their usual broad spectrum of influences here, the more obvious examples being Igor Stravinsky, Gil Evans and Weill-Brecht through to Zappa, Byrne and Zorn. The influence of the latter grouping comes into the eponymous CD-2, a bite-size prototype of FES called X-Legged Sally (compiled from five recordings issued between 1988 and 1997) run by its director and reedsman Peter Vermeersch, a recording that's in tune with the swampy, electric new wave-y sound of that period. It's the roots of the FES sound and it's well worth a listen. Finally CD-3 is a compilation of FES ‘live’ in action, where they're at their best, between 2000 and 2012 recorded mostly in Belgium but also at London's Vortex. The line up is expansive and there are guest contributions from the likes of pianist Uri Caine, Swiss pop-electronica artist Jimi Tenor and the Dutch cellist Ernst Reijseger. All in all, this is a package that's a near perfect entry point to enjoying the kaleidoscopic musical anarchy of one of Belgian jazz's finest.
